It heats almost instantly, and for travel it has a storage sleeve in case you need to stash it while it's still hot. It smooths hair, tames frizz and sets long-lasting curl in my straight, thick hair, but can also be used like a straightener, just pulling it along the hair length for shiny results. It doesn't burn the ends of my colored hair, either, and has several heat settings. Well worth the great price.
